I’ve found that experimenting with different infill patterns can really optimize print strength while saving material. For prototyping, I switched to a hexagonal infill for a recent project, and it significantly cut down on weight without compromising integrity. @CAD_Enthusiast, have you tried varying infill configurations in your designs? It might just change how you approach material choices.
